Early 1960's Persian silk fabric with boteh design and pacific blue Indian silk douppion cushion decorated with a late 20th century white ribbon with raised embroidery soutache woven motif. The pocket is in pacific blue silk with blue matching zip.
The ribbon comes from french ribbon maker Julien Faure's archive, one of the only ribbon makers who has survived into the 21st century. They now specialise in Haute Couture ribbons for luxury houses such as Chanel, Louis Vuitton, Hermes and Prada amongst others
Cushion size: 21 x 17 cm
